Fishing Tackle into Jewelry

You don't have to blow a lot of cash to make jewelry! Next time you get the itch to go down the jewelry-making aisle at your local craft store (you guys know what I'm talking about!!), go down the sporting goods aisle at your local dollar store first.

Craftster member retro-redux scored these fishing accessories at the dollar store and transformed them into joining links for a clever necklace that showcased buttons from her stash as beads. Sweet!

Project Estimate:

  • Fishing accessories $1
  • Jump Rings $1 or so
  • Buttons (on hand)

Total cost: $2
